Common questions about National Enterprise Systems
Is National Enterprise Systems licensed to collect debt in Texas?
Yes. National Enterprise Systems has an active $10,000 surety bond on file with the Texas Secretary of State (SoS File 20050062), which is the legal requirement for third-party debt collectors under Texas Finance Code Chapter 392, last checked July 9, 2026.
Does National Enterprise Systems have complaints on record?
The public CFPB Consumer Complaint Database records 762 debt-collection complaints referencing National Enterprise Systems, as of July 9, 2026. This is the total on record and links to the live CFPB database; a complaint is a record, not a verdict, and larger agencies naturally accrue more.
